The US Federal Trade Commission (FTC) has blocked data firm InMarket Media from selling or licensing precise location data, alleging the firm failed to obtain informed consent from app users regarding the use of their data. It also accused InMarket of retaining location data longer than necessary. Earlier this month, the FTC also settled a case with data broker Outlogic over the sale of location data. InMarket denied the FTC allegations and said it was enhancing protections of sensitive location data.
